Kubernetes automates deployment, scaling, and management of containerized applications — helping teams reduce manual work and improve uptime through features like self‑healing, automated rollouts, service discovery, and horizontal scaling. Training that covers core concepts like pods, deployments, services, networking, and hands‑on cluster management prepares learners to confidently build and operate resilient, scalable applications in real environments — skills that are increasingly in demand in DevOps and cloud engineering roles.

Continuous Integration is a DevOps software development practice where developers regularly merge their code changes into a central repository, after which automated builds and tests are run. Read more click here
